T ELEMENTS OF VOCABULARY : 1. solicit, verb 2. massive, adjective 3. vitamin, noun 4. annually, adverb EVERYDAY LIVING WORDS 56 GLOSSARY A glossary is an alphabetical index of useful terms. In this book, glossary entries are drawn from the various activities of everyday life. adamant not giving in easily; firm; unyielding bigot a prejudiced, narrowminded person with strong, stubbornly held opinions expunge to erase or remove completely feasible possible; capable of being done under conditions as they are gross total; entire; with nothing taken away hoard to collect and stow away, often secretly innate given by nature; seeming to have been born in a person jettison to throw away or get rid of lackluster dull; not bright, interesting, or forceful libel the crime of printing something that unfairly damages a person’s reputation net what is left after certain amounts have been subtracted nostalgia a wishing for something that happened long ago or is now far away nurture to care for; to help someone or something grow and develop permeate to pass through or spread through every part roster a list naming members of a group, such as students, soldiers, or teammates WORDS IN CONTEXT Use words from the glossary to complete the sentences. 1.
